Full-time Human Resources Coordinator Position at Green Sage Cafe
$35,000+ Depending on Experience
Green Sage Cafe Offices inside Merrimon location

Essential Job Functions:
* Develop Green Sage's team based on employee satisfaction, commitment to the brand, and wellness
* Field questions from all employees and address employee concerns
* Assist with Recruitment and Hiring Process
* Participate in recruitment and interview process
* Assist in the completion of new employee applications
* Ensure reference checks are completed, when required
* Maintain and update recruitment database (Bamboo)
* Process all employee data changes in a timely manner following all procedures
* Update hiring database records and process paperwork for new hires, terminations and other status changes
* Provide new hire orientations including an overview of Training, HR, Benefits, food standards, and Safety
* Assist in policy development around HR and Training
* Benefits administration
* Create employee communications including emails, flyers, and ads.
* Assist in the completion and processing of Accident Reports
* Reports directly to CEO
Education, Experience, and Skills:
* High School diploma or GED equivalent
* At least 1 year administrative/hiring experience
* Strong problem-solving skills
* Strong interpersonal skills
* Able to communicate clearly, both written and orally, as to communicate with current employees, potential employees, and members of the management team
* Must be able to prioritize and plan work activities as to use time efficiently
* Must be organized, accurate, thorough, and able to monitor work for quality
* Must be dependable, able to follow instructions, respond to management direction, and must be able to improve performance through management feedback
* Advanced computer skills
* Excellent time management skills
* Ability to work independently
